What is www.aka.ms/phonelink?
In today's fast-paced digital world, staying connected across multiple devices is essential for productivity and convenience. Microsoft’s Phone Link (formerly known as Your Phone) is a powerful tool that allows users to seamlessly integrate their smartphone with a Windows PC. By visiting www.aka.ms/phonelink, you can connect your Android or iPhone to your computer, enabling a wide range of features such as notification syncing, messaging, calls, file sharing, and even app mirroring.
www.aka.ms/phonelink is a shortcut URL provided by Microsoft that redirects users to the setup page for Phone Link, a built-in Windows application that connects your smartphone to your PC.
With Phone Link, you can:
✅ Sync notifications from your phone to your PC
✅ Send and receive SMS messages directly from your desktop
✅ Make and receive calls without picking up your phone
✅ Access and run Android apps on Windows
✅ Transfer files and photos wirelessly between devices
✅ Sync clipboard and browsing activity for a seamless experience
This feature is available on Windows 10 and Windows 11, and it supports most Android and iOS devices.

How to Set Up Phone Link via www.aka.ms/phonelink
Setting up Phone Link is quick and easy. Follow these steps:
Step 1: Visit www.aka.ms/phonelink on Your PC
- Open a web browser on your Windows PC and visit www.aka.ms/phonelink.
- If you don’t already have the Phone Link app installed, download it from the Microsoft Store.
Step 2: Install the Companion App on Your Phone
For Android users:
- Download the Link to Windows app from the Google Play Store.
- Alternatively, visit www.aka.ms/yourpc on your phone to get the correct app.
For iPhone users:
- Install the Phone Link app from the App Store.
- Ensure Bluetooth is enabled for proper syncing.
Step 3: Pair Your Phone with Your PC
- Open the Phone Link app on your computer.
- Launch the Link to Windows app on your smartphone.
- Scan the QR code displayed on your PC screen.
- Follow the on-screen instructions to grant permissions for notifications, calls, and messages.
Step 4: Customize Your Experience
Once connected, you can personalize settings such as which notifications to sync, enabling app mirroring, and setting up file transfer options.
System Requirements for Phone Link
For Windows PC:
✔ Windows 10 (October 2018 update or later) or Windows 11
✔ Bluetooth-enabled PC (required for call functionality)
✔ Microsoft Account (for seamless integration)
For Android Phones:
✔ Android 7.0 or later
✔ Link to Windows app installed
For iPhones:
✔ iOS 14 or later
✔ Limited features compared to Android (no app mirroring)
Troubleshooting Common Issues
1. Phone Not Connecting to PC
- Ensure both devices are connected to the same Wi-Fi network.
- Restart both your phone and PC.
- Uninstall and reinstall Phone Link and Link to Windows.
2. Calls Not Working
- Make sure Bluetooth is enabled on both devices.
- Reconnect your phone via Bluetooth in the Windows settings.
3. Notifications Not Syncing
- Allow notification access for Link to Windows in your phone’s settings.
4. Unable to See Mobile Apps on PC
- Ensure your phone is Samsung Galaxy or Surface Duo (some features are limited to specific Android devices).
- Make sure both Windows and Phone Link are up to date.
